+    @staticmethod
+    def process_numa_memory(
+        numa: dict, node_id: Optional[int], extra_specs: dict
+    ) -> None:
+        """Set the memory in extra_specs.
+        Args:
+            numa        (dict):         A dictionary which includes numa information
+            node_id     (int):          ID of numa node
+            extra_specs (dict):         To be filled.
+
+        """
+        if not numa.get("memory"):
+            return
+        memory_mb = numa["memory"] * 1024
+        memory = "hw:numa_mem.{}".format(node_id)
+        extra_specs[memory] = int(memory_mb)
+
+    @staticmethod
+    def process_numa_vcpu(numa: dict, node_id: int, extra_specs: dict) -> None:
+        """Set the cpu in extra_specs.
+        Args:
+            numa        (dict):         A dictionary which includes numa information
+            node_id     (int):          ID of numa node
+            extra_specs (dict):         To be filled.
+
+        """
+        if not numa.get("vcpu"):
+            return
+        vcpu = numa["vcpu"]
+        cpu = "hw:numa_cpus.{}".format(node_id)
+        vcpu = ",".join(map(str, vcpu))
+        extra_specs[cpu] = vcpu
+
+    @staticmethod
+    def process_numa_paired_threads(numa: dict, extra_specs: dict) -> Optional[int]:
+        """Fill up extra_specs if numa has paired-threads.
+        Args:
+            numa        (dict):         A dictionary which includes numa information
+            extra_specs (dict):         To be filled.
+
+        Returns:
+            vcpus       (int)           Number of virtual cpus
+
+        """
+        if not numa.get("paired-threads"):
+            return
+        # cpu_thread_policy "require" implies that compute node must have an STM architecture
+        vcpus = numa["paired-threads"] * 2
+        extra_specs["hw:cpu_thread_policy"] = "require"
+        extra_specs["hw:cpu_policy"] = "dedicated"
+        return vcpus
+
+    @staticmethod
+    def process_numa_cores(numa: dict, extra_specs: dict) -> Optional[int]:
+        """Fill up extra_specs if numa has cores.
+        Args:
+            numa        (dict):         A dictionary which includes numa information
+            extra_specs (dict):         To be filled.
+
+        Returns:
+            vcpus       (int)           Number of virtual cpus
+
+        """
+        # cpu_thread_policy "isolate" implies that the host must not have an SMT
+        # architecture, or a non-SMT architecture will be emulated
+        if not numa.get("cores"):
+            return
+        vcpus = numa["cores"]
+        extra_specs["hw:cpu_thread_policy"] = "isolate"
+        extra_specs["hw:cpu_policy"] = "dedicated"
+        return vcpus
+
+    @staticmethod
+    def process_numa_threads(numa: dict, extra_specs: dict) -> Optional[int]:
+        """Fill up extra_specs if numa has threads.
+        Args:
+            numa        (dict):         A dictionary which includes numa information
+            extra_specs (dict):         To be filled.
+
+        Returns:
+            vcpus       (int)           Number of virtual cpus
+
+        """
+        # cpu_thread_policy "prefer" implies that the host may or may not have an SMT architecture
+        if not numa.get("threads"):
+            return
+        vcpus = numa["threads"]
+        extra_specs["hw:cpu_thread_policy"] = "prefer"
+        extra_specs["hw:cpu_policy"] = "dedicated"
+        return vcpus
